Output 81ca8371aaa28e2517ed32c6752621523abe30e58216fd2b363731e61c3f2470:22

value
6613812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d663ccd86f264db1609aa638c3dc2ca3dc9d3f3 OP_EQUAL
address
3D84s7J9NxYLFfLNq1hxM5hSXtWHQKpbLr
transaction
81ca8371aaa28e2517ed32c6752621523abe30e58216fd2b363731e61c3f2470